Where is the Norseen family from?

You can see how Norseen families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Norseen family name was found in the USA, and Canada between 1911 and 1920. The most Norseen families were found in Canada in 1911. In 1911 there were 10 Norseen families living in Quebec. This was about 91% of all the recorded Norseen's in Canada. Quebec had the highest population of Norseen families in 1911.
